What Makes This Release Special
The "Reimagined" treatment means Jordan Brand isn't just reissuing the classic 1989 silhouette—they're elevating it with modern craftsmanship while maintaining the soul of the original design. The signature black nubuck upper receives premium treatment, while the classic cement grey accents and fiery red details remain perfectly faithful to Tinker Hatfield's revolutionary design.
Key Features:
- Premium black nubuck construction
- Original "Bred" color blocking
- Reimagined materials with enhanced quality
- Classic visible Air sole unit
- Wings lace locks for customizable fit
Historical Significance
The original "Bred" Jordan 4 gained immortality through Michael Jordan's iconic shot over Craig Ehlo in the 1989 NBA playoffs—forever known as "The Shot." This moment cemented the shoe's legendary status and created a cultural phenomenon that continues to resonate 35 years later.
